Scramblase is a protein responsible for the translocation of phospholipids between the two monolayers of a lipid bilayer of a cell membrane. In humans, phospholipid scramblases (PLSCRs) constitute a family of five homologous proteins that are named as hPLSCR1–hPLSCR5. Phospholipid scramblase 1 (PLSCR1) , a lipid-binding protein that enters the nucleus via the nonclassical NLS (257) GKISKHWTGI (266) . The structure of the nuclear localisation sequence of scramblase PLSCR1 complexed to importin was determined using X-ray diffraction with a resolution of 2.20 Ångströms. It is found in most mammals including humans. The import sequence lacks a continuous stretch of positively charged residues, and it is enriched in hydrophobic residues. Thus, Scramblase can transport negatively charged phospholipids from the inside of the cell to the outside of the cell. The importin structure is composed of many alpha helices that integrate the protein into membranes. The role of importin is to move proteins such as scramblase into the nucleus.
